Name : armadillo Product : Fedora 10 Version : 0.6.12 Release : 2.fc10 URL : http://arma.sourceforge.net/ Summary : Fast C++ matrix library with interfaces to LAPACK and ATLAS Description : Armadillo is a C++ linear algebra library (matrix maths) aiming towards a good balance between speed and ease of use. Integer, floating point and complex numbers are supported, as well as a subset of trigonometric and statistics functions. Various matrix decompositions are provided through optional integration with LAPACK and ATLAS libraries. A delayed evaluation approach is employed (during compile time) to combine several operations into one and reduce (or eliminate) the need for temporaries. This is accomplished through recursive templates and template meta-programming.
